Installation failures
Hi,
I'm trying to install several apps (Firefox, Thunderbird, etc.) on an older machine running Win98 First Edition. However, the Setups crash after "Checking archive integrity" without further notice, i.e. no dialog boxes, log files etc. Some other post referred to problems with the Microsoft Installer. I have tried to reinstall this; the result was something like "Service already present" and installation aborted. I have also disabled all Startup entries via MSCONFIG and rebooted, but the Setups still fail. (Firefox and Thunderbird run fine when copied to that machine via XCOPY). What is going on here and what needs to be done (without reinstallation of Windows)? Thanks, Andreas |
